[opensuse-factory] Suspend nightmare

After reading the thread on auto hibernation I selected suspend from the
kde3 log out menu. It had never worked in the past but this time
unfortunatly it did. My machine went through the shutdown process and
after pressing the power button proceeded to restart, finished the part
where it loads the saved suspend data and locked up just before
the mouse would have been recognized. The nightmare part came when
repeated attempts from rescue disk to kexec back to my system also
failed. Eventually I booted with acpi=off and noresume successfuly my
failsafe section on the boot menu is identical to my normal section for
some reason as well.
Is this a known bug, if it is the suspend section needs to be removed
from kde3 shutdown menu.
